SLFP MP Ranjith Siyamabalapitiya appointed as Deputy Speaker again

Sri Lanka Freedom Party (SLFP) MP Ranjith Siyambalapitiya has been appointed as new Deputy Speaker for the second consecutive time. 

He was appointed after he obtained 148 votes through a manual ballot. The Opposition nominated SJB MP Imtiaz Bakeer Markar who received only 65 votes.

Thanking the ones who voted in support of him, MP Siyambalapitiya said that he stepped down from his position earlier when the Group of SLFP Members became independent and later became an opposition group.

He said that at the time he did not need to resign from the post which is rather independent, yet taking a step forward he took the action to strengthen the action taken by the SLFP group.

He said that he was saddened that the opposition failed to make use of the opportunity which was given to them by his resignation.

Mr Siyambalapitiya’s name was suggested by SLFP member Nimal Siripala de Silva, while the General Secretary of the Samagi Jana Balawegaya (SJB), Rnjith Madduma Bandara proposed the name of Imthiaz Bakeer Maker for the same position.

Prof G.L Peiris told the house that the SLPP would also vote for Ranjith Siyambalapitiya. Following that the speaker called for manual voting.

However, the Opposition Leader and the former Leader of the House Kiriella called for a secret ballot without MPs being required to place their names and signatures. However, Speaker Mahinda Yapa Abeywardena said that members should sign the ballot papers according to standing orders.

Opposition member Earn Wickramaratne citing standing orders said that the secrecy of the identity of the MP’s should be preserved and therefore after the voting the ballot papers should be destroyed before their sight.
